    Lawrence, Kansas is a dynamic, university-driven city known for its progressive values, cultural richness, and civic energy. Nestled in Northeast Kansas just off I-70 and K-10, Lawrence blends small-town friendliness with metropolitan access to Kansas City (30 minutes from downtown) and 40 minutes to new KCI Airport. Home to the University of Kansas and Haskell Indian Nations University, the city boasts a highly educated population, a thriving arts scene, and one of the most celebrated downtowns in the country—Massachusetts Street (“Mass Street”).

     

    The City operates under a Council-Manager form of government. The City Commission consists of five at-large, elected members. The Mayor and Vice Mayor are selected by the City Commission annually. The City Manager’s Office provides executive leadership and strategic coordination across all municipal departments and partner agencies. The City Manager oversees all City operations and serves as the chief administrative officer of the organization.
